Warm up idle ?

Before I go somewhere I let my SH get up to temp. I run it at idle, no choke, for about three minutes if I haven't used it in a few hours. After that it'll either cut out or the idle will drop to about 750RPM and I have to cut it off and back on again. Once I start it back up it runs fine. Is this just a weird quirk or something else? Thanks for any help.

A little extra info. Started happening after I changed the spark plugs. Temp is normal to cold when it happens.

By the sound of it, it's not normal. VTRs (at least mine) is pretty slow to warm up. I have to let it idle for at least 15-20 min before the fan will kick on, but it will never die. Sounds to me like something happened when you changed the plugs. Ensure you have the right plugs installed (DPR9EIX9) and the plug wires are fully seated on the plugs. Check your tank hoses to make sure they are all installed correctly and that none get pinched when you reinstall the tank. That's about all I have to offer on this one. It's obviously related to the plug change since it didn't do this before the maintenance.
